Russian authorities in 2024 demanded that Google remove a record 784 thousand pieces of content
The company removed just over 30 thousand units In 2024, the amount of content on Google platforms that Russian authorities demanded to remove increased by 20%, to 784 thousand units, according to a Google transparency report analyzed by Vorstka. This figure was a record since 2009, from which statistics are available. Overall, the amount of content required to be removed by Russian authorities has increased annually for fourteen years in a row.
